About Redeemer Reformed Presbyterian
Redeemer Reformed Presbyterian Church in Queensbury is a Christ-centered congregation belonging to the Presbyterian Church in America. The church emphasizes Bible-based worship and discipleship, gathering for Sunday morning worship at 10:30 a.m. and evening worship on the second through fifth Sundays at 6:00 p.m. The community offers nursery care for young children, Sunday School for adults and children during autumn, winter, and spring seasons, and midweek Bible studies for men and women. Beyond Sunday worship, the church sponsors Christian Service Brigade and Girls Growing Gracefully programs for children and teens, hosts Life Together gatherings for young families, and cooperates with other churches to serve the broader community through initiatives like Ambassadors Soccer Camp.
First-Time Visitor Info for Redeemer Reformed Presbyterian
Dress Code: Not specified — please contact the church directly. Service Format: Sunday morning worship at 10:30 a.m. with nursery available for children up to age 5; evening worship at 6:00 p.m. on the second through fifth Sundays; covered dish luncheon following the first Sunday morning service. Visitor Tips: The church celebrates the Lord's Supper on the first Sunday morning and third Sunday evening of each month. Special seasonal services include Palm Sunday, Maundy Thursday worship with a sister congregation, and Easter celebration with breakfast. All visitors are welcome to participate in worship, Sunday School, and fellowship events.
